Most parents send their child to the public school closest to where they live. Every child has the right to attend their designated neighbourhood school. Parents also have the choice to enrol your child at a school outside of your designated neighbourhood zone. Our school is able to accept enrolments outside of our zone as long as we have enough space. Once our school is full, we cannot accept enrolments from outside of our neighbourhood zone.
